Select this button to
activate/deactivate voice
instructions. Select off to no
longer hear voice instructions.
You will still receive
information such as traffic
information and warning
sounds.Tip:you can
deactivate the warning
sounds by selecting
“Settings”, then “Sounds and
warnings”.
Select this button to
increase/decrease the screen
brightness and display the
map in brighter/darker
colours. When driving at night
or in unlit tunnels, watching
the screen is more
comfortable and less
distracting for the driver if the
map uses darker colours.
Tip:the device will
automatically switch between
day and night view depending
on the time of day. To
deactivate this function, select
“Appearance” in the
“Settings” menu and deselect
the option "Switch to night
colours" when it is dark.
Map update
To ensure optimal performance, the
navigation system must be updated
periodically. For this, theMopar®Map
Careservice offers a new map update
every three months.The updates can be downloaded from
the maps.mopar.eu website and
installed directly on the navigator in
your car. All updates are free of charge
for 3 years from the start of the
warranty on the car. The navigation
system can also be updated at the Fiat
Dealership (the dealer may charge for
updating the navigation system).
